Coimbatore Galaxy Rotaract Club and PSG College Students Provide Petty Shop to Differently-Abled Couple

In Coimbatore, the Galaxy Rotaract Club and PSG College students joined hands to support a differently-abled couple by providing them with a petty shop, enhancing their livelihood opportunities.


Coimbatore: In a heartwarming gesture, the Coimbatore Galaxy Rotaract Club and students from PSG College of Arts and Science have come together to support a differently-abled couple by providing them with a petty shop. This initiative aims to improve the livelihood of persons with disabilities in the city.

The beneficiaries, Theresanathan and Viji, a differently-abled couple residing in the Soolur Housing Board Colony, received the petty shop from the joint efforts of the Rotaract Club and B.Com Retail Management students from PSG College. The event, which took place recently, saw participation from numerous Rotaract Club members and college students.

It's worth noting that Theresanathan is a wheelchair cricket player, adding significance to the support provided to the couple. This initiative not only helps in improving their economic condition but also serves as an inspiration to other differently-abled individuals in the community.

The collaboration between the Coimbatore Galaxy Rotaract Club and PSG College students demonstrates the power of community engagement and social responsibility. Such efforts play a crucial role in creating an inclusive society and providing equal opportunities for all, regardless of their physical abilities.
